The global nuclear moisture separator reheaters market is expected to grow at a CAGR of 3.5% during the forecast period, to reach USD 1.2 billion by 2030. The growth of this market is driven by the increasing demand for nuclear power generation and the need for efficient and reliable equipment in order to meet stringent safety requirements. The global nuclear moisture separator reheaters market is segmented on the basis of type, application, and region. On the basis of type, it is classified into horizontal MSR and vertical MSR; on the basis of application, it is classified into PWRs, PHWRs, HTGRs, FBRs and BWRs; on the basis of region it includes North America (NA), Latin America (LA), Europe (EU), Asia Pacific (APAC) and Middle East & Africa (MEA).
